Output d827470716580d83335d39dabb32985ff2366974e9e5ae3183b64294dfaca424:1

value
74645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a5bba372e1c9f8bd7dcdd832acff91c988d52d3 OP_EQUAL
address
38UBp556fRTbK5p9VHwcmP5rAntyR24pD3
transaction
d827470716580d83335d39dabb32985ff2366974e9e5ae3183b64294dfaca424
confirmations
280731
spent
true